Barriers to entry are High, driven by significant intellectual property portfolios, stringent regulatory hurdles (FDA/CE), and the deep, trust-based relationships between established suppliers and orthopedic surgeons.

Pricing for these components is value-based, reflecting significant investment in R&D, clinical studies, regulatory approval, and surgeon training, rather than a simple cost-plus model. The final price to a provider is heavily influenced by Group Purchasing Organization (GPO) contracts, committed volumes, and the strategic importance of the hospital system to the supplier. The price build-up includes raw materials, precision CNC machining, sterilization, quality assurance, and substantial Sales, General & Administrative (SG&A) costs.
The most volatile cost elements are raw materials and specialized labor. Recent price pressures include: 1. Medical-Grade Titanium (Ti-6Al-4V): est. +18% (24-month trailing) due to resurgent aerospace demand and supply chain constraints. 2. Medical-Grade Stainless Steel (316LVM): est. +12% (24-month trailing) following general commodity market trends. 3. Skilled CNC Machinist Labor: est. +7% (annualized) in key US/EU manufacturing hubs due to labor shortages.
| Supplier | Region | Est. Market Share | Exchange:Ticker | Notable Capability |
|---|---|---|---|---|
| DePuy Synthes | Global | est. 35-40% | NYSE:JNJ | Unmatched portfolio breadth and GPO penetration. |
| Stryker | Global | est. 20-25% | NYSE:SYK | Leader in modular systems and trauma software. |
| Smith & Nephew | Global | est. 10-15% | NYSE:SNN | Expertise in complex deformity correction (Taylor Spatial Frame). |
| Zimmer Biomet | Global | est. 10-15% | NYSE:ZBH | Strong brand equity and comprehensive trauma solutions. |
| Orthofix Medical | Global | est. 5-7% | NASDAQ:OFIX | Specialized focus on external fixation and biologics. |
| Acumed | Global | est. <5% | (Private) | Niche leader in upper/lower extremity solutions. |

| Risk Category | Grade | Justification |
|---|---|---|
| Supply Risk | Medium | Market is highly consolidated. However, the top 4 suppliers are stable, and multiple sourcing options exist. |
| Price Volatility | Medium | Raw material costs are volatile, but high product margins and long-term contracts provide a partial buffer. |
| ESG Scrutiny | Low | Focus remains on patient safety and device efficacy. Sterilization and waste are minor, secondary concerns. |
| Geopolitical Risk | Low | Manufacturing is geographically diverse across North America and Europe, mitigating single-region dependency. |
| Technology Obsolescence | Medium | Core technology is mature, but software-assisted frames and new materials could make current systems less competitive. |
